Not known Factual Statements About what is md5 technology
Not known Factual Statements About what is md5 technology
Blog Article
For these so-known as collision attacks to operate, an attacker really should be capable to govern two individual inputs within the hope of ultimately obtaining two different combos that have a matching hash.
The reason for this is this modulo Procedure can only give us ten different outcomes, and with 10 random quantities, there is nothing halting some of These outcomes from remaining precisely the same number.
This article on MD5 will largely focus on the background, security issues and applications of MD5. For those who have an interest during the fundamental mechanics with the algorithm and what comes about over a mathematical degree, head more than to our The MD5 algorithm (with examples) posting.
MD5 (Message Digest Algorithm five) can be a cryptographic hash operate that generates a unique 128-bit hash benefit from any enter knowledge. It is often used in cybersecurity to validate the integrity of documents and to check checksums of downloaded information with These provided by The seller.
Help us improve. Share your ideas to enhance the post. Contribute your experience and create a big difference inside the GeeksforGeeks portal.
Collision Resistance: MD5 was to begin with collision-resistant, as two individual inputs that give a similar hash price ought to be computationally unachievable. In follow, on the other hand, vulnerabilities that help collision assaults are identified.
Instead of counting on the MD5 algorithm, fashionable alternatives like SHA-256 or BLAKE2 offer more robust stability and much better resistance to assaults, making sure the integrity and protection of one's programs and facts.
The top hashing algorithm will depend check here on your preferences. Selected cryptographic hash capabilities are Employed in password storage to make sure that simple textual content passwords are hashed and kept safer during the celebration of a info breach.
In the context of MD5, a 'salt' is an extra random price that you choose to add in your knowledge right before hashing. This makes it Significantly more difficult for an attacker to guess your knowledge based on the hash.
While MD5 was as soon as a broadly adopted cryptographic hash functionality, a number of important negatives are actually recognized after a while, bringing about its decrease in use for protection-related programs. They include things like:
This workshop will supply you with worthwhile insights into knowing and dealing with the Instagram algorithm, a appropriate and practical software of the newfound knowledge on this planet of social media.
Podio consolidates all venture data—written content, discussions and procedures—into a single tool to simplify challenge administration and collaboration.
A different weak spot is pre-impression and 2nd pre-graphic resistance. What does this necessarily mean? Perfectly, Preferably, it ought to be unachievable to deliver the first enter facts from its MD5 hash or to search out a unique enter Together with the very same hash.
By distributing this type, I realize and acknowledge my information will likely be processed in accordance with Progress' Privacy Plan.